March Weather in Vadodara, India

Last updated: August 21, 2025

March in Vadodara, India, ushers in the onset of warmer days, with maximum temperatures soaring to 42°C (108°F) and an average temperature of 28°C (83°F). The air feels pleasantly dry, as humidity levels remain low at 25%, providing some relief from the heat. With just 1 mm (0.0 in) of precipitation and no rainy days, the month is characterized by clear skies and ample sunshine, making it a vibrant time to experience the city’s blooming landscapes. March Precipitation in Vadodara

March in Vadodara typically sees a meager precipitation of just 1 mm (0.0 in), maintaining the dry spell established in the earlier winter months of January and February, which recorded no rainfall. This minimal rainfall marks a gradual transition into the wetter conditions anticipated in the following months. As the city approaches the monsoon season, which usually kicks off in June with a significant uptick in precipitation, the stark contrast becomes evident. The dry March offers a brief respite before the intense rainy season takes hold, particularly evident in July and August, when the city receives the bulk of its annual rainfall. March Humidity in Vadodara

In March, Vadodara experiences a marked dip in humidity, dropping to a relatively dry 25%. This shift follows the cooler months of January and February, which recorded higher humidity levels of 47% and 34%, respectively. As the city transitions deeper into the year, April sees an even lower humidity of 20%, indicating a trend toward drier conditions before the heat intensifies. Interestingly, the onset of the monsoon season in June brings a sudden increase, with humidity levels soaring to 37%, eventually peaking in the following months—July and August—when it reaches a sweltering 79% and 90%, respectively. UV Risk Categories

  •  Extreme (11+): Avoid the sun, stay in shade.
  •  Very High (8-10): Limit sun exposure.
  •  High (6-7): Use SPF 30+ and protective clothing.
  •  Moderate (3-5): Midday shade recommended.
  •  Low (0-2): No protection needed.

March Sunshine in Vadodara

March in Vadodara, India, heralds the arrival of bright days, with an impressive 342 hours of sunshine—a notable increase from February's 296 hours. This upward trend continues into April, where sunshine peaks at 346 hours, creating a delightful warmth that invites residents and visitors alike to enjoy the outdoors. As spring unfolds, the steady rise in daylight hours showcases Vadodara's transition into a sunnier season, hinting at the forthcoming heat of May, which boasts the highest total of the year at 374 hours. March Winds in Vadodara

In March, Vadodara's winds remain gentle, maintaining a consistent average speed of 2.1 m/s (5 mph), mirroring the calmness of the preceding months. This steady breeze is characteristic of the early spring, providing a refreshing contrast to the rising heat of April, when the wind speed slightly increases to 2.2 m/s (5 mph). As the months progress into summer, the winds begin to strengthen, peaking at 3.8 m/s (8 mph) during the monsoon season in June.
